Group Classe
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Rappresenta un gruppo di dati.
public ref class Group : Microsoft::ReportingServices::RdlObjectModel::ReportObject, Microsoft::ReportingServices::RdlObjectModel::IDataScope
[System.ComponentModel.TypeConverter(typeof(Microsoft.ReportingServices.RdlObjectModel.Group/GroupConverter))]
public class Group : Microsoft.ReportingServices.RdlObjectModel.ReportObject, Microsoft.ReportingServices.RdlObjectModel.IDataScope
[<System.ComponentModel.TypeConverter(typeof(Microsoft.ReportingServices.RdlObjectModel.Group/GroupConverter))>]
type Group = class
inherit ReportObject
interface INamedObject
interface IDataScope
interface IContainedObject
Public Class Group
Inherits ReportObject
Implements IDataScope
- Ereditarietà
- Attributi
- Implementazioni
Costruttori
| Group() |
Crea una nuova istanza della classe Group. |
Proprietà
| ComponentMetadata |
Ottiene o imposta i metadati del componente. (Ereditato da ReportObject) |
| DataElementName |
Ottiene o imposta il nome da utilizzare per l'elemento dati per le istanze del gruppo. |
| DataElementOutput |
Ottiene o imposta un valore che indica se le istanze del gruppo verranno visualizzate a seguito del rendering dei dati. |
| DocumentMapLabel |
Ottiene o imposta un'etichetta per identificare un'istanza del gruppo all'interno dell'Interfaccia utente client (per fornire un'etichetta intuitiva per la ricerca). Vedere ReportItem.Label |
| DocumentMapLabelLocID |
Ottiene o imposta l'identificatore univoco per la proprietà DocumentMapLabel. |
| DomainScope |
Ottiene o imposta l'ambito del dominio del gruppo. |
| Filters |
Ottiene o imposta i filtri da applicare a ogni istanza del gruppo. |
| GroupExpressions |
Ottiene o imposta le espressioni in base alle quali raggruppare i dati. |
| Name |
Ottiene o imposta il nome del gruppo. |
| PageBreak |
Ottiene o imposta il comportamento dell'interruzione di pagina per il gruppo. |
| PageBreakProperties |
Ottiene o imposta le proprietà dell'interruzione di pagina. |
| PageName |
Ottiene o imposta il nome della pagina del gruppo. |
| Parent |
Ottiene o imposta l'espressione che identifica il gruppo padre in una gerarchia ricorsiva. È consentita solo se il gruppo dispone esattamente di una espressione di raggruppamento. Indica che se i filtri applicati al gruppo eliminano il padre di un'istanza di gruppo, questo verrà trattato come un figlio del padre. In caso di ciclo verrà ignorata una delle relazioni padre-figlio. |
| ParentTablixMember |
Ottiene l'elemento padre dell'oggetto TablixMember. |
| ReGroupExpressions |
Ottiene o imposta le espressioni in base alle quali raggruppare i gruppi di dati. |
| Site |
Ottiene o imposta il sito associato all'oggetto ReportObject. (Ereditato da ReportObject) |
| Variables |
Ottiene o imposta un elenco di variabili da valutare a livello di gruppo. |
Metodi
| DeepClone() |
Restituisce un clone completo di questa istanza di ReportObject. (Ereditato da ReportObject) |
| GetContainingDataScopes() |
Restituisce l'elenco dell'oggetto report contenente gli ambiti dei dati. (Ereditato da ReportObject) |
| GetDataScopesForDefaultImpl(IContainedObject) |
Restituisce gli ambiti dei dati per l'implementazione predefinita. (Ereditato da ReportObject) |
| GetDependenciesCore(IList<ReportObject>) |
Restituisce le dipendenze nell'elemento principale per l'oggetto ReportObject. (Ereditato da ReportObject) |
| Initialize() |
Inizializza un'istanza della classe Group. |
| InitializeForDesigner() |
Inizializza l'oggetto report per la finestra di progettazione. (Ereditato da ReportObject) |
| OnChildPropertyChanged(Int32, Object, Object) |
Genera un evento quando la proprietà dell'elemento figlio è stata modificata. (Ereditato da ReportObject) |
| OnPropertyChanged(Int32, Object, Object) |
Genera un evento quando la proprietà è stata modificata. (Ereditato da ReportObject) |
| RdlSemanticEqualsCore(ReportObject, ICollection<ReportObject>) |
Restituisce un valore che indica se la semantica del linguaggio RDL è la stessa dell'oggetto principale. (Ereditato da ReportObject) |
| SavePropertyValue<T>(String, T, ReportObject.SwapValue) |
Salva il valore della proprietà dell'oggetto report. (Ereditato da ReportObject) |
Implementazioni dell'interfaccia esplicita
| IComponent.Disposed |
Si verifica quando l'oggetto ReportObject viene eliminato. (Ereditato da ReportObject) |
| IDataScope.Group |
Ottiene il gruppo di dati. |
| IDisposable.Dispose() |
Esegue attività definite dall'applicazione, come rilasciare o reimpostare risorse non gestite. (Ereditato da ReportObject) |